Originally published in 1934, this book contains the Page lectures for that year in the Berkeley Divinity School, New Haven, Connecticut. Contents include - Job - Socrates - Pascal - Newman - The Gospel For An Age of Doubt.

One day in Paris Cyril Belshaw reported that his wife Betty had disappeared without a trace. Soon afterward her mutilated corpse was discovered concealed on a mountainside--and Cyril was charged with her murder.This is the story of a typical Canadian academic couple--happily married, well-off, well-travelled, their children grown--whose lives go terribly wrong. Soon after the discovery of Betty Belshaw’s body, Swiss police began to reconstruct a chain of events--including Cyril Belshaw’s marital infidelity--that ultimately led to his incarceration and trial for her killing.
